openapi: 3.1.0 info: title: Datadog Logs API description: >- The Datadog Logs API allows you to search and send log events to the Datadog platform over HTTP. It supports querying and aggregating log data from the Log Management product. Logs can be searched using Datadog's log query language, and results can be aggregated using facets and measures. Accepts log payloads in JSON format. Each log entry can include a message, hostname, service name, source, tags, and additional custom attributes. Supports batching multiple log entries in a single request. The maximum payload size is 5 MB for the HTTP intake endpoint. Supports full-text search and structured queries using Datadog's log query language. Results are paginated and can be sorted by timestamp. Queries can filter by log attributes, facets, tags, service, source, hostname, and status. Supports count, sum, avg, min, max, and percentile aggregations grouped by one or more facets. Results can be used for building analytics charts, dashboards, and reports. Each index defines a filter for which logs to include, a daily retention policy, and log volume limits. Indexes are evaluated in order, and each log can match at most one index. Index configurations affect log retention, querying capabilities, and cost. tags: - Log Indexes responses: '200': description: Successful response with list of log indexes content: application/json: schema: $ref: '#/components/schemas/LogsIndexesResponse' '401': description: Unauthorized - missing or invalid API key content: application/json: schema: $ref: '#/components/schemas/APIErrorResponse' '403': description: Forbidden - insufficient permissions for this operation content: application/json: schema: $ref: '#/components/schemas/APIErrorResponse' x-microcks-operation: delay: 0 dispatcher: FALLBACK /api/v1/logs/config/indexes/{name}: get: operationId: getLogIndex summary: Datadog Get a Log Index description: >- Returns the configuration details for a specific log index identified by its name.
